Avon Tech R's?

I've been runnig Kumho E V700's on the car and want to step up a bit, but as always the budget won't allow Hoosiers or the 710's. Has anyone run on the Avon Tech R's? How do they compare to the E V700's? Tire Rack has them for only $13 more than the Kumho's in my size (225/45/15).

Primary focus is auto-x with a few trackdays every year. My E V700's have done 2 track days and about 80 - 90 auto-x runs on them. They wear well, but the grip was gone a while ago.

They are amazing autox tires. I absolutely LOVED them on my turbo Miata last year. They are very soft. Grip everywhere and a very progressive break away. They durometered 10 points softer than a Hoosier 03A. Forget what the exact number was though. I will try them on the ITS car in the spring though I am concerned about wear on the big track since they are so soft.
